NCAA Announces “Much-Needed Assistance” to Perpetuate Duke Dynasty
Posted by Lance Haley in Business and Money, CBS, CBS Sports, Humor, Media & Communication, Show Them the $$$, Sports on April 22nd, 2010
As has been widely anticipated, the NCAA will now expand the men’s national basketball championship tournament from a field of 64 teams to 68 teams. There was speculation that the field could be expanded to as many as 96 teams.
However, every little bit of help will be greatly appreciated by CBS, Duke and the NCAA.
Moreover, all of the games will be televised from beginning to end. So Jim Nance, Clark Kellogg, Bill Packer and Dick “Dukey” Vitale can cover all six Duke games on CBS, and push the other #1 seeds’ games over to Turner Broadcasting while they get knocked out of the tournament. See how much sense this makes?
Everyone makes more $$$$$$.
So let’s see, the NCAA basketball tournament selection committee can now take a few more of the higher-seeded teams that would have been in Duke’s bracket, spread them around to the other three brackets, and take the new 67-68-69-70 teams and put them in Duke’s bracket – “for procedural reasons“, of course.
There, that should “fix it” even better.
